To embark on the journey of privatizing your Facebook profile, commence by navigating to the “Settings & Privacy” tab located on the dropdown menu accessible from your profile picture. Once there, click on “Privacy” to reveal a plethora of options pertaining to the privacy of your personal information. The first step towards ensuring the seclusion of your profile is to modify the “Who can see your future posts?” setting to “Friends” or “Only me.” This action restricts the visibility of your future posts to only those within your circle of Facebook friends or to yourself alone.

Furthermore, delve into the “Who can see your past posts?” setting to review the visibility of your existing posts. Here, you can choose to limit the audience of your past posts to a specific group of friends or to yourself. Additionally, consider utilizing the “Limit Past Posts” feature to restrict the visibility of older posts to friends added after a certain date. By implementing these measures, you can effectively control the extent to which your past and future posts are shared with others.

How to Make a Private Profile on Facebook

Making your Facebook profile private is a great way to protect your personal information and control who sees your posts and updates. Here are the steps on how to do it:

  1. Click the down arrow in the top right corner of Facebook and select “Settings & Privacy.”
  2. Click “Privacy”
  3. Under “Your Activity,” click “Edit” next to “Who can see your future posts?”
  4. Select “Friends” from the dropdown menu.
  5. Click “Save Changes.”

Can I make my Facebook profile private from certain people?

Yes, you can make your Facebook profile private from certain people by:

  • Blocking them from your Facebook account.
  • Adding them to your “Restricted” list.
  • Adjusting your privacy settings to limit what they can see on your profile.
